ECHOES
Enoch Oghenakhoghe Azage
MAY 28 – JUN 19
Echoes is exhibition of a body of work by Azage Enoch Oghenakhoghe, featuring small portrait paintings from his Echoes and Becoming series of paintings.They are deeply rooted in identity, emotional memory, vulnerability, and transformation.
Presented on small canvasses, the artist constructs psychologically charged portraits that exist between clarity and fragmentation. Each work reflects on the evolving nature of self hood, revealing moments of tension, introspection, and emotional presence.
Enoch finishes off each painting in this series with looses scribbles asserting change in every situation of daily life and interaction with others.
